Output 66c04da32b2da6a5daeb11f6df8a8cd94b9c49b2bcaee27d50782278e489b99a:12

value
2118956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0f3b907521ebe3259243fda61e2a422e5a43aa9 OP_EQUAL
address
3Pf44jkNckwU5kg4cXL2PhU7Bw1d6ndmJP
transaction
66c04da32b2da6a5daeb11f6df8a8cd94b9c49b2bcaee27d50782278e489b99a
spent
true